CVE-2006-03410.040.08Jan 6, 2006Cross-site scripting (XSS) vulnerability in WCONSOLE.DLL in Rockliffe MailSite 5.x and 6.1.22 and earlier allows remote attackers to inject arbitrary web script or HTML via the query string.
CVE-2006-07900.000.01Feb 19, 2006Rockliffe MailSite 7.0 and earlier all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service by sending crafted LDAP packets to port 389/TCP, as demonstrated by the ProtoVer LDAP testsuite.
CVE-2006-03420.000.02Jan 21, 2006RockLiffe MailSite HTTP Mail management agent (httpma) 7.0.3.1 all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(CPU consumption and crash) via a malformed query string containing special characters such as "|".
CVE-2006-01290.000.01Jan 9, 2006Mail Management Agent (MAILMA) (aka Mail Management Server) in Rockliffe MailSite 7.0.3.1 and earlier generates different responses depending on whether or not a username is valid, which allows remote attackers to enumerate valid usernames via user requests to TCP port 106.
CVE-2006-01280.000.01Jan 9, 2006Buffer overflow in the IMAP service of Rockliffe MailSite before 6.1.22.1 allows remote attackers to have an unknown impact via unknown attack vectors.
CVE-2006-01270.000.01Jan 9, 2006Directory traversal vulnerability in the IMAP service of Rockliffe MailSite before 6.1.22.1 allows remote authenticated users to rename the folders of other users via a .. (dot dot) in the RENAME command.
CVE-2006-01300.000.01Jan 9, 2006Mail Management Agent (MAILMA) (aka Mail Management Server) in Rockliffe MailSite 7.0.3.1 and earlier allows remote attackers to attempt authentication with an unlimited number of user account names and passwords without denying connections, limiting the rate of connections, or locking out an account.
CVE-2005-34290.000.01Nov 2, 2005Rockliffe MailSite Express before 6.1.22, with the option to save login information enabled, saves user passwords in plaintext in cookies, which allows local users to obtain passwords by reading the cookie file, or remote attackers to obtain the cookies via cross-site scripting (XSS) vulnerabilities.
CVE-2005-34310.000.01Nov 2, 2005Absolute path traversal vulnerability in Rockliffe MailSite Express before 6.1.22 allows remote attackers to read arbitrary files via a full pathname in the AttachPath field of a mail message under composition.
CVE-2005-34300.000.01Nov 2, 2005Incomplete blacklist vulnerability in Rockliffe MailSite Express before 6.1.22 allows remote attackers to upload and execute arbitrary script files by giving the files specific extensions, such as (1) .unk, (2) .asa, and possibly (3) .htr and (4) .aspx, which are not filtered like the .asp extension.
CVE-2005-34280.000.01Nov 2, 2005Cross-site scripting (XSS) vulnerability in Rockliffe MailSite Express before 6.1.22 allows remote attackers to inject arbitrary web script or HTML via a message body.
CVE-2005-32870.000.01Oct 23, 2005Incomplete blacklist vulnerability in Mailsite Express allows remote attackers to upload and possibly execute files via attachments with executable extensions such as ASPX, which are not converted to .TXT like other dangerous extensions, and which can be directly requested from the cache directory.
CVE-2005-32880.000.01Oct 23, 2005Mailsite Express allows remote attackers to upload and execute files with executable extensions such as ASP by attaching the file using the "compose page" feature, then accessing the file from the cache directory before saving or sending the message.
CVE-2000-03980.000.02May 24, 2000Buffer overflow in wconsole.dll in Rockliffe MailSite Management Agent allows remote attackers to execute arbitrary commands via a long query_string parameter in the HTTP GET request.
